OPPO F7 (4GB RAM + 64GB) vs Huawei Nova 2
Here you can compare OPPO F7 (4GB RAM + 64GB) and Huawei Nova 2. Comparing OPPO F7 (4GB RAM + 64GB) vs Huawei Nova 2 on Smartprix enables you to check their respective specs scores and unique features. It would potentially help you understand how OPPO F7 (4GB RAM + 64GB) stands against Huawei Nova 2 and which one should you buy The current lowest price found for OPPO F7 (4GB RAM + 64GB) is ₹14,994 and for Huawei Nova 2 is ₹15,137. The details of both of these products were last updated on May 07, 2024.
Specification | OPPO F7 (4GB RAM + 64GB) | Huawei Nova 2 |
---|---|---|
Display | 6.23 inches, 1080 x 2280 pixels | 5 inches, 1080 x 1920 pixels |
OS | Android v8.1 (Oreo) | Android v7.0 (Nougat) |
Rear Camera | 16 MP with autofocus | 12 MP + 8 MP with autofocus |
Battery | 3400 mAh, Li-ion Battery | 2950 mAh, Li-Po Battery |
Internal Memory | 64 GB | 64 GB |
Price | ₹14,994 | ₹15,137 |
